For to us a child is born,      
to us a son is given, and
the government shall be upon his shoulder
and his name shall be called
Wonderful Counselor, Mighty God,
       Everlasting Father, Prince of Peace.

Of the increase of his government and of peace
   there will be no end,
     on the throne of David and over his kingdom
   to establish it and to uphold it
  with justice and with righteousness
   from this time forth and forevermore.
         The zeal of the Lord of hosts will do this.

Isaiah 9:6, 7 ESV

On this Holy Child rested
the government of the Universe
and even as an infant His rule was a threat
to Rome and to the Sanhedrin,
the political rulers of His world and
the religious leaders of His day.

His reign came with His coming and
a throne was His right of birth.
He came to establish His throne on David's precedent
and He reigns today, the Unseen King.
His Kingdom is ever moving and increasing until
one day it will burst onto earth in full and dazzling splendor.

The Magi called Him "King of the Jews"
the title on His final cross.
Foreigners, they knew and cherished His position,
while His "own received Him not."
That they knew a King was born is astonishing enough,
that they traveled months to honor the Child King is amazing.

As Gentiles, not Jews, their presence in the scene is both prophetic and shocking.
The mystery remains of their identity
and how it was they came to
anticipate the birth of this Jewish King,
Child of another culture and a different race.
We guess of Daniel's influence centuries before
by the exile in Persia.
But explanation would not dim the phenomena
of their presence and their lavish gifts.       

The Magi knew His kingship but worshiped Him as God.
The Child King as God was the Magi's secret knowledge
and it was known by no one else in the story
(save Mary and Joseph).

Herod feared His government enough to murder.
The shepherds acknowledged Him as Savior
but they had no announcement of His government..
        
Christ's true presence brings His dominion.
And that Lordship disturbs
the rule of man and of satan.
The result is glory and death.

"But his citizens hated him, and sent
a delegation after him, saying,
          'We do not want this man to reign over us.'"

Luke 19:14 NASB

Adam's family does not want His dominion.
The rule was stolen long ago.

But Jesus was born to reign, to bear a government
and build a kingdom.
That kingdom is being "established and upheld" in this hour,
to be unveiled in a future hour.

. . . and He will reign over the house of Jacob forever;
and His kingdom will have no end.
Luke 1:33 NASB

He is the final King and the Only True King.
Long before His birth He was named Prince of Peace.

At this remembrance of His birth, let us celebrate
the Crown over the cradle!       

This Christ Child, born with the right of government,
came to carry humanity on His servant-shoulders.
His is the true Kingdom in which we His children,
rest now and forever.

"A Child is born, a Son is given to us."
He is given to us!
His reign is a gift, a safety, a comfort.
His kingdom is the end of human tyranny and satanic rule!
His is a blessed throne whose rule is our Love and Peace.

We do not think of the Christmas Infant as a King,
that from birth
His destination was a throne by way of a cross.

So this Christmas may we welcome and worship,
as did the Magi...

the Christ Child, our King.
